Raise the declared minimums in pubspec.yaml to what our deps already require: Flutter >=3.35.0 / Dart >=3.9.0 (was 3.19.0 / 3.5.0). alchemist 0.12 needs Flutter 3.32; Dart 3.9 first ships in Flutter 3.35, so 3.35 is the binding floor. Pin the exact build toolchain in .fvmrc (Flutter 3.44.1). Moving to the Dart 3.9 language level switches `dart format` to the new "tall" style and enables two new lints. This commit is the resulting mechanical churn, isolated from any behaviour change: - whole-tree `dart format` reformat (tall style) - `dart fix` for unnecessary_underscores + use_null_aware_elements No runtime behaviour change; `make test` green.
